    Botswana’s “Young Minds Africa Trust” Receives Recognition from UNAOC-BMW Group’s Intercultural Innovation Hub

    November 27, 2024
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Reddit Telegram Email

    CASCAIS, PORTUGAL / ACCESSWIRE / November 27, 2024 / “Young Minds Africa Trust”, based in Botswana, is one of ten global grassroots initiatives recognized by the prestigious Intercultural Innovation Hub, a joint initiative of the United Nations Alliance of Civilizations (UNAOC) and the BMW Group, implemented with the support of Accenture, during a Ceremony held in the framework of the 10th UNAOC Global Forum in Cascais, Portugal under the theme “United in Peace: Restoring Trust, Reshaping the Future – Reflecting on Two Decades of Dialogue for Humanity”. The Forum convened prominent figures, political leaders, UN officials including the United Nations Secretary-General, António Guterres, as well as representatives from civil society, academia, and the private sector, to share insights and reflect on the 20 years of the United Nations Alliance of Civilizations’ impactful work.

    The organization was recognized for its project “Model Parliament Africa,” an innovative all-women simulated parliament programme designed to equip participants with practical legislative skills and experience. Through this initiative, Young Minds Africa Trust promotes a more inclusive society by empowering young women to engage actively in civic leadership and advocate for greater political representation. By fostering a deep understanding of political processes, the project aims to increase female participation and promote gender balance within parliaments across the region, ultimately encouraging equitable and inclusive political leadership.

    “Receiving this prestigious recognition from the Intercultural Innovation Hub not only validates Young Minds Africa’s work but also provides us with the resources to expand our ‘Model Parliament’ program. We look forward to continuing to advocate for gender parity and equality in politics in the African continent,” said Laone Tiny Desert, Co-Founder and Executive Director of Young Minds Africa Trust.

    The Intercultural Innovation Hub supports grassroots initiatives that promote intercultural dialogue and understanding, thereby contributing to peace, cultural diversity, and more inclusive societies. This year’s Ceremony was chaired by Mr. Miguel Ángel Moratinos, UN Under-Secretary-General and the High Representative for UNAOC, and Ms. Ilka Horstmeier, Member of the Board of Management of BMW AG People and Real Estate, Labour Relations Director.

    Through the Intercultural Innovation Hub, Young Minds Africa Trust will receive a financial grant, as well as one year of capacity-building and mentorship support from UNAOC, the BMW Group, and Accenture, to help strengthen the “Model Parliament Africa” project and its contribution towards a more inclusive society. This model of collaboration between the United Nations and the private sector creates a more profound impact, as partners provide their respective expertise to ensure the sustainable growth of each supported project.
